Output 65f60f1b65be3759543042b21f15cfef2c3eb6ecfe2b5fdaf3ba985e00a87e84:1

value
722990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df3c14c41117b76cc352e19547baa9cc870c315b OP_EQUAL
address
3N3NaqA7i2tvkzegxktwAVwruDtQsFvaoi
transaction
65f60f1b65be3759543042b21f15cfef2c3eb6ecfe2b5fdaf3ba985e00a87e84
spent
true